As noun
  1. 1

    A heavy cavalry sword with a curved blade and a single cutting edge.

    "The historical officer drew his gleaming sabre as the cavalry charge began."
  2. 2

    A light fencing sword with a flexible triangular blade used for thrusting and cutting.

    "She won the Olympic gold medal in the women's individual sabre fencing event."
